| This chatbot is designed to answer questions related to the mediation practice and philosophy of the late Dr John M Haynes (1932-1999). | |
| John Haynes is often called the father of mediation. He trained thousands of mediators and court personnel at a time when mediation was becoming differentiated from couples therapy. He was a pioneer who set out to describe the first theoretical elements of the profession. | |
